Output 128cbae22845fde0bc9155c27082e8b44b19411dad9fb4a9825a48ff249d6959:20

value
62668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afd3b5a9c2d40b398e9a680790ea43d423e00972 OP_EQUALVERIFY OP_CHECKSIG
address
1H2gsQwNFBm9gTyPfrXa63tTQPbFvLbLjy
transaction
128cbae22845fde0bc9155c27082e8b44b19411dad9fb4a9825a48ff249d6959
spent
true